Responsibilities
- Preparing patients for exams and treatments, including taking vitals and medical histories
- Performing procedures such as venipuncture, EKGs, urinalysis, and immunizations
- Maintaining clean and well-stocked exam rooms and sterilizing medical equipment
- Educating patients on medications, treatments, and preventive health practices
- Assisting providers with minor procedures and physicals
- Managing referrals, test scheduling, patient records, and supply inventory
- Following all safety, infection control, and regulatory guidelines (CLIA, OSHA, etc.)
- Collaborating with patients and the care team to ensure a smooth and supportive experience
Additional Responsibilities for LPNs
- Triage medical questions and manage refill requests in collaboration with medical providers
- Monitor HIT tools and alerts related to patient care coordination
- Conduct hospital discharge follow-ups to ensure continuity of care
- Serve as a nursing consultant to care team members and assist in treatment planning
- Collaborate with providers regarding significant health information and updates
